MLB Network Broadcast ‘MLB All-Star Red Carpet Show’ On Tuesday, July 13

July 7, 2010 · 0 comments

MLB Network will broadcast the sixth annual MLB All-Star Red Carpet Show presented by Chevrolet on Tuesday, July 13. Baseball fans will have opportunity to watch their favorite All-Star baseball Hall of Famers on the streets of Anaheim.

Baseball Hall of Famers Rod Carew and Reggie Jackson will lead the parade as it makes its way from the corner of Harbor Blvd. at Convention Way north to Disney Way and through the gates of Disneyland park down Main Street U.S.A. for guests visiting the park.

MLB All-Star Red Carpet Show begins at 11:30 a.m. PT featuring all Major League Baseball All-Stars as well as the AL and NL All-Star team managers all riding in Chevrolet Flex-Fuel Silverados.

MLB Network will telecast the event nationally at 4:00 p.m. ET/1:00 p.m. PT and air an abbreviated version at 7:30 p.m. ET/4:30 p.m. PT.

Rodney Cline “Rod” Carew is a former Major League Baseball player, member of the Baseball Hall of Fame. He is renowned for his hitting prowess. Carew played for the Minnesota Twins and the former California Angels from 1967 to 1985. He threw right-handed and batted left-handed.

Reginald Martinez “Reggie” Jackson is a former American Major League Baseball right fielder who played for four different teams from 1967 to 1987 and currently serves as a special advisor to the New York Yankees. Jackson helped win three consecutive World Series titles as a member of the Oakland A’s in the early 1970s and also helped win two consecutive titles with the New York Yankees. He was inducted into the Hall of Fame in 1993.

Baseball fans are able to view the parade along Convention Way and along Harbor Blvd, ending at the intersection of Disney Way and Harbor Blvd., beginning at 10:00 a.m. PT.
